E. A. Markham (1939-2008) lived mainly in Britain and Europe since the mid-1950s. He built houses in France, worked as a media co-ordinator in Papua New Guinea and directed the Caribbean Theatre Workshop. He was Professor of Creative Writing at Sheffield Hallam University. He died in Paris in 2008.
